# Psy Orbit
A "listen together" mode built into Psysonic. One participant hosts the music, others tune in and listen in sync. Guests can suggest tracks; the host decides what lands in the queue.
No external servers, no relays, no accounts on yet another platform — Orbit piggybacks entirely on your existing Navidrome instance. Sessions live in regular playlists (with a small JSON blob in the comment field), the clients poll and write to those playlists, and that's it.

## For users
### Starting a session (host)
Click **Psy Orbit** in the top bar → **Create a session**. The start modal opens with:
- **Session name** — a random playful name is generated; edit it or reroll with the dice button.
- **Max guests** — cap on concurrent participants (132). You don't count.
- **Invite link** — ready to copy and share the moment the modal opens. Pre-generated from a fresh session id + the slugified name.
- **Clear my queue first** — optional. Start with an empty queue (guest suggestions land fresh) vs. keep your current queue and share it with the guests.
Click **Start Orbit**. The session bar appears at the top of the window (session name, participant count, shuffle countdown, settings / share / help / exit buttons). The link is now live — share it.
### Joining (guest)
Two equivalent paths:
1. **Paste anywhere** — copy the invite link the host sent you. Anywhere in Psysonic (not inside a text field), press `Ctrl+V` (`Cmd+V` on macOS). A confirm dialog shows who invited you; click Join.
2. **Launch popover** — click **Psy Orbit** in the top bar → **Join a session** → paste the link into the field → Join.
Either path performs the same preflight: validates the link, checks the session still exists, handles server switches automatically if the link points at another Navidrome you have an account for. If you have **multiple accounts** on the target server, a small picker asks which one to join as.
### Suggesting tracks
Anywhere a song row appears (album, playlist, favorites, artist top-songs, search results, random mix, advanced search):
- **Double-click** a row → adds just that track.
- **Right-click → "Add to Orbit session"** — same effect, via context menu.
- **Single-click** on a row shows a toast hint: "Double-click to add". This is deliberate — a single click normally drops the whole album into your queue, which would spam the shared queue and annoy everyone.
Explicit bulk buttons (**Play All** / **Play Album** / **Play Playlist** / Hero play / Album-card play) ask for a confirmation first inside an active session. On confirm, the tracks are **appended** to the shared queue, never replacing it.
### Approvals
By default, a new session starts with **auto-approve off**. Guest suggestions land in the session's suggestion history but not the actual playback queue — the host decides.
The host sees a prominent **Pending approvals** strip at the top of the queue panel: each pending track with cover, title, artist, and "Suggested by …" line, plus two buttons:
- ✓ Accept — enqueues the track into the host's player queue. Guests see it appear in the shared queue on the next tick.
- ✕ Decline — drops the suggestion. It stays in the suggestion history for audit but won't show up again in the approval strip.
Auto-approve can be toggled on in the session settings for any session where manual approval isn't needed.
### Shared queue
Both hosts and guests see a strip at the top of the queue panel with the session name and a comma-separated list of all participants (host first). Under that:
- **Host** view: regular queue, with any new guest suggestions injected into random positions inside the upcoming range.
- **Guest** view: read-only display of the host's upcoming queue (up to 30 tracks at a time) with submitter attribution — "by alice" for host-chosen tracks is omitted; "suggested by alice" is shown for guest suggestions.
When the guest has in-flight suggestions that haven't been merged yet, they appear in a separate **Waiting for host** section above Up next, with a clock icon. Once the host (auto-)approves and merges, they move into the normal list.
### Session settings
Open via the gear icon in the session bar (host only):
- **Auto-approve suggestions** — on/off. Default off.
- **Automatic reshuffle** — on/off. Periodically FisherYates-shuffles the upcoming queue.
- **Reshuffle every** — 1 / 5 / 10 / 15 / 30 min preset picker. Disabled when auto-reshuffle is off.
- **Shuffle now** — one-shot manual shuffle + bumps the next-auto-shuffle timer.
### Participants
Click the participant count in the session bar. Opens a popover:
- Host row at the top with a crown icon.
- Each connected guest with a user icon, username, and join timestamp.
- Host-only actions per guest: **Remove** (drops them from the session, can re-join via the invite link) vs. **Ban** (permanently blocked for the lifetime of the session). Both confirm before firing.
Guests see the same list but read-only — no action buttons.
### Ending the session
- **Host clicks X** → confirm dialog → session closes for everyone. Server playlists are deleted automatically.
- **Guest clicks X** → confirm dialog → just the guest leaves. Session continues for everyone else.
- **Host goes silent for 5 minutes** (network drop, app crash, laptop lid) → guests auto-leave with a dedicated "Host went silent" modal.
- **App close / force quit** → next app launch sweeps up any orphaned session playlists you own (`__psyorbit_*` with stale heartbeat).
### The help modal
Every screen with the session bar has a `?` icon between settings and X that opens a 9-section walk-through of everything above, with keyboard navigation (arrow keys between sections, Enter to expand).

## Requirements & limits
- **Same Navidrome server.** Everyone — host and all guests — must be logged into the same Navidrome instance. Orbit links encode the server URL, and Psysonic auto-switches on paste if you have an account there.
- **Separate accounts.** Each participant needs their own Navidrome user. If a host and guest log in as the same user, their outbox playlists collide and suggestions get lost. This is a hard limit of the current design — Orbit identifies participants by username.
- **Public server address for remote guests.** Guests outside your home network need your server reachable at a public hostname. The start modal warns you if you're currently connected via a LAN address.
- **Host presence matters.** Guests auto-leave after 5 minutes of no host activity. Shorter reconnects (network blips, phone screen off, whatever) are invisible.
- **Session size.** State is bounded to ~4 KB per playlist comment. In practice that's plenty for a session name, participants list, and a suggestion history; there's no hard cap on tracks through the actual playback queue.

## How it works (technical)
### Design goals
1. **No external infrastructure.** Everything runs on your Navidrome. No relay, no auth server, no persistent state anywhere you don't already own.
2. **No protocol changes.** Uses Navidrome's existing Subsonic/OpenSubsonic playlist endpoints. If your server can host a normal playlist, it can host an Orbit session.
3. **Degrade gracefully.** A dropped tick doesn't break a session. Network blips are silent. Missing heartbeats expire cleanly. Crashes clean up on the next launch.
4. **Host-authoritative.** The host's player is the ground truth; guests mirror. No distributed consensus, no leader election.
### Playlists as transport
Every session creates two kinds of playlists on the server (names are stable and start with `__psyorbit_`):
| Playlist | Who owns it | What's in it |
|---|---|---|
| `__psyorbit_<sid>` | host | Canonical session state (4 KB JSON blob) in the playlist **comment**. Track list is always empty. |
| `__psyorbit_<sid>_from_<user>__` | each participant | Outbox. Comment holds a heartbeat timestamp; the track list holds pending guest suggestions. |
All playlists are marked `public: true` so every participant can read them via the normal Subsonic endpoints (`getPlaylist.view`, `getPlaylists.view`). Psysonic filters `__psyorbit_*` out of its own UI (Playlists page, pickers, context menu), but the Navidrome web client will show them while a session is active.
### The host tick
Fired every 2.5 s from `useOrbitHost`:
1. **Sweep all outboxes.** List every `__psyorbit_<sid>_from_<user>__` playlist. For each one, read the current tracklist (= new suggestions from that guest) and the heartbeat timestamp from the comment.
2. **Apply snapshots to state.** Rebuild the `participants` array from heartbeat freshness (anyone with a heartbeat < 30 s old is "alive"). Append new suggestions to `state.queue` as `OrbitQueueItem { trackId, addedBy, addedAt }`.
3. **Clear each swept outbox's tracklist** (heartbeat stays). Single-pass consume — a track the host has seen is the host's problem now, not the outbox's.
4. **Merge into player queue** (when auto-approve is on, and the suggestion isn't host-authored or already merged). Each merged track gets sprinkled at a random position in the upcoming range so host picks and guest suggestions interleave.
5. **Maybe shuffle.** If auto-shuffle is on and the interval elapsed, FisherYates-reorder the upcoming play queue + rewrite `state.lastShuffle`.
6. **Snapshot playback.** Write `isPlaying`, `positionMs`, `positionAt` (wall-clock), `currentTrack`, and a 30-item slice of the upcoming play queue (`playQueue`) into the state blob.
7. **Write.** Serialise and push to the session playlist's comment via `updatePlaylist.view`.
Host also writes a heartbeat to its own outbox every 10 s so the participants pipeline treats the host symmetrically.
### The guest tick
Fired from `useOrbitGuest` — fast polling (500 ms) until the first successful sync lands, then steady 2.5 s:
1. **Read the session playlist comment** via `getPlaylist.view`. Parse the OrbitState.
2. **Check for session death:** comment empty → session-ended; `state.ended === true` → session-ended; `state.positionAt` older than 5 min → host-timeout.
3. **Check kick / remove:** if the local username is in `state.kicked` or has a fresh entry in `state.removed`, transition to the appropriate exit modal.
4. **Reconcile pending suggestions.** For every trackId the local client has submitted, check if it's appeared in `state.playQueue` or `state.currentTrack`. If so, drop it from the local "pending" list (the UI hides it automatically).
5. **Auto-sync to host.** Three cases:
- Different track at host → load it locally (`playTrack`), seek to `estimateLivePosition(state, now)`, mirror `isPlaying`. Never touches the local player if the guest has locally diverged (paused on their own).
- Same track, play/pause flipped at host → mirror only if the guest hasn't locally diverged since the last tick.
- First tick after join → mirror unconditionally (initial sync).
6. **Heartbeat tick** (independent, every 10 s): write `{ ts: Date.now() }` into the guest outbox comment.

### State shape
All relevant types in `src/api/orbit.ts`:
```ts
interface OrbitState {
v: 3;
sid: string; // 8 hex chars
host: string; // navidrome username
name: string; // human-readable session name
started: number; // ms since epoch
maxUsers: number;
currentTrack: OrbitQueueItem | null;
isPlaying: boolean;
positionMs: number;
positionAt: number; // wall-clock ms of the last snapshot
queue: OrbitQueueItem[]; // suggestion history
playQueue: OrbitQueueItem[]; // 30-item slice of host's upcoming
playQueueTotal: number;
participants: OrbitParticipant[];
kicked: string[];
removed: { user: string; at: number }[];
lastShuffle: number;
settings: {
autoApprove: boolean;
autoShuffle: boolean;
shuffleIntervalMin: 1 | 5 | 10 | 15 | 30;
};
ended: boolean;
}
interface OrbitQueueItem {
trackId: string;
addedBy: string; // navidrome username
addedAt: number;
}
```
The state blob is size-bounded to 4 KB (serialised JSON). `serialiseOrbitState` throws `OrbitStateTooLarge` above the budget so callers can trim optional fields and retry.
### Cleanup
Three layers of defense against orphaned playlists:
1. **Explicit exit.** `endOrbitSession` (host) or `leaveOrbitSession` (guest) deletes the participant's own playlists synchronously. The happy path.
2. **Server-switch teardown.** Switching Navidrome servers tears the current session down first (up to 1.5 s), then switches. Prevents "in session against wrong server" states.
3. **App-start orphan sweep.** Every app launch runs `cleanupOrphanedOrbitPlaylists`: lists every `__psyorbit_*` playlist the current user owns, parses the heartbeat from the comment, deletes anything with a heartbeat older than 5 minutes (or `ended: true`, or an unparseable comment). The current local session is always protected.
The 5-minute TTL is a conservative compromise: long enough to survive a brief app restart (and a session running on another device of yours), short enough that a dead session doesn't clutter the server indefinitely.
### Security & privacy
- **Authentication.** Uses Navidrome's own user system. Participants are identified by their username; no additional auth layer.
- **Public playlist visibility.** Session and outbox playlists must be `public: true` so guests can read them. Side effect: they're visible to *any* user on the same Navidrome instance while the session is active. Psysonic's own UI filters them; the Navidrome web client does not.
- **No external servers.** Orbit is strictly peer-to-peer via the Navidrome instance you already trust. No data leaves your server.
- **No message signing.** Since everything is owned by authenticated Navidrome users, we rely on the server's own ACLs. A guest can't modify the host's session playlist (different owner), only their own outbox.
- **Track IDs only.** The state blob references tracks by their Navidrome ID. No filenames, no paths, no stream URLs.

## Edge cases handled
- **Host offline < 15 s.** Silent. Guests extrapolate via `estimateLivePosition` (positionMs + elapsed wall-clock).
- **Host offline 15 s 5 min.** Guest UI shows a yellow "Host offline" badge next to the session name. Playback continues locally.
- **Host offline > 5 min.** Guest auto-leaves with a "Host went silent" modal. Cleanup of guest outbox runs on dismissal.
- **Guest pauses locally.** The guest's local pause survives host track changes — the next-track event won't silently un-pause them. "Catch up" brings them back in sync.
- **Guest resume in orbit.** Pressing play (player bar, media keys, MPRIS) in an active session is interpreted as "catch up" — loads the host's current track and seeks to the live position, not "resume the locally frozen track".
- **Bulk "Play All" in-session.** Dialog: "Add 14 tracks to the Orbit queue?" On confirm, appended. On cancel, no-op.
- **Single-click on song row in-session.** Swallowed; shows "Double-click to add" toast.
- **Multiple accounts on target server.** Paste flow opens an account picker modal. Keyboard-navigable.
- **Server switch while in session.** Teardown runs before switch. Any server-resident session playlists get cleaned up by their host's next app-start sweep.
- **Initial sync race.** The guest's first tick retries on 500 ms cadence until the player state actually matches the host's last-known track (up to 2 s per attempt, then falls through with a best-effort mirror).
- **`positionAt` stale on join.** Seek fraction is clamped to [0, 0.99] — prevents `audio:ended` from firing at the very start of a join.
- **Outbox deletion mid-session** (cleanup race): host sees the guest drop out on the next sweep; guest's next heartbeat recreates the outbox if they're still connected.
- **Session playlist deleted** (cleanup race while the guest's local store says it's still active): guest treats as "ended", shows the exit modal.
